In 2015, I proposed the iterative nonlocal residual approach for solving nonlocal field problems. In fact, complications are exist when solving the field equation in the nonlocal field. This has been attributed to the complexity of deriving explicit forms of the nonlocal boundary conditions. Thus, the paradoxes in the existing solutions of the nonlocal field equation have been revealed in recent studies. Via the iterative nonlocal residual approach, it is easy to determine the elastic nonlocal fields from their local counterparts without solving the field equation.
